2) Unless you have a specific use for it, turn off ident checking with
'rfc_1413_timeout = 0s' in your Exim config. This will stop Exim
trying to do an ident query to the client, which may be dropping ident
traffic at a firewall.


Peter

Extra underscore there will prevent Exim starting/restarting, should be:

rfc1413_query_timeout = 0s

and don't forget that 's' either... ;-)

(tested each way...  ;-)
